The Smoky Bear Trucking Company claims that the average weight of a fully loaded moving van is no more than 12,000 lb. The highway patrol decides to check this claim. A random sample of 30 Smoky Bear moving vans shows that the average weight (X bar) is 12,200 lb. with a sample standard deviation (S) of 800 lb.

1. Write the null and alternate hypotheses for a statistical test to determine if there is evidence that the average weight of a Smoky Bear moving van is more than 12,000 lb.

2. Find the critical value of the t-statistic with a 10% level of significance. 

3. Find the t-test statistic from the sample data. 

4. Find the p-value.

5. State the conclusion reached by the Highway Patrol.
